What is Kickstarter - Boost Your Campaign

  • サマリー

  • Kickstarter is an online crowdfunding platform that enables individuals, groups, and organizations to raise funds for creative projects and ideas. Launched in 2009, Kickstarter has become one of the most prominent platforms for crowdfunding, particularly for projects in the realms of art, music, film, technology, design, gaming, and more.

    Creators, often referred to as project creators, can launch campaigns on Kickstarter by setting a funding goal and a deadline for reaching it. They provide detailed descriptions of their projects, including what it aims to accomplish, how the funds will be used, potential risks, and updates on progress. Creators also offer incentives or rewards for backers who pledge various levels of financial support.

    Backers, on the other hand, are individuals or groups who support projects by making monetary pledges. They can choose to pledge any amount they desire, and their pledges are only collected if the project reaches its funding goal within the specified timeframe. Backers often receive rewards or incentives based on the amount they pledge, which can range from exclusive digital content to physical products related to the project.

    Kickstarter operates on an "all-or-nothing" model, meaning that if a project fails to reach its funding goal by the deadline, no money is collected from backers, and the project creator does not receive any funds. This model helps to ensure that creators have the necessary resources to bring their projects to fruition before funds are disbursed.

    Overall, Kickstarter provides a platform for creative individuals and innovators to access funding, engage with a community of supporters, and turn their ideas into reality. It has facilitated the launch of thousands of successful projects, ranging from innovative gadgets to groundbreaking artistic endeavors.
